Well....for the last couple weeks we've had most trips catching 40 to 50 shorts to get a 3 man limit west and northwest of Westsister, but for some reason today we decided to venture east to Huron to look for something bigger. Left the house around 5:30, first stop was the area I call the shelf, in close west of the lighthouse halfway to Sawmill trolling Bandits, nothing but monster sheephead and catfish. 2nd stop north towards the dumping grounds, nothing but knats...not even a pullback. 3rd stop kellys schoal....nothing but 1 sheephead pulling bandits, harnesses and spoons. 4th stop Cranberry Creek, tons of marks and unbearable knats....caught about 30-40 shorts pulling the smaller bandits, harnesses ,spoons and everything else we had in the boat, a couple white perch and sheepheed.
